Coolest Places To Work
ENGIE Iowa is recognized as a Coolest Places to Work by the Corridor Business Journal (CBJ). Each year the CBJ’s Coolest Places to Work award identifies and honors local companies that have created the most engaging and rewarding work environments across Iowa. Through anonymous employee surveys, the results are collected and tabulated by a third party vendor and the awardees are announced each year in December. Engie Iowa has 150 local employees in their Iowa City and Coralville facilities.
